Samantha Karev has known nothing more than disappointment, abandonment, and hurt over the course of her life. Her older brother Alex was a big inspiration to her and she owed him a lot. 

At a young age, Alex had to care for her and her siblings when their mom became mentally unstable and their dad abandoning them in a time of need. 

After a while of the Karev siblings being on their own, they were split up and sent into different foster homes. 

Eventually, at the age of 18, Samantha followed in her older brother's footsteps - becoming a surgeon to help others when nobody would help the siblings. 

With all of the issues Samantha has faced, throw in an abusive ex-boyfriend who treated her so horribly, she had been sent to the hospital on many occasions. 

Now she's in Seattle, Washington, where her brother Alex now resides. 

She didn't know that Seattle would be her new home, let alone find love in Seattle.
